Failure to read the patch test sites later than 48 hours after application would result in a significant number of missed truepositive responses, especially for formaldehyde, quaternium15, neomycin, and ethylenediamine dihydrochloride. Ethylenediamine is a potent sensitiser used in topical medications, particularly antibioticsteroid creams for its chemical stabilizing properties. Comparison of the true test patch test system with the chamber system recommended by the north american contact dermatitis group showed concordance of results in 98% of tests with nickel, epoxy resin, and ethylenediamine dihydrochloride. Patient information sheet ethylenediamine dihydrochloride. Ethylenediamine is used as a stabilizer, emulsifier, and preservative in topical fungicides, antibiotic creams, eye drops, and nose drops. The most common source of allergic reaction to ethylenediamine dihydrochloride is contact with topical antifungal, antibacterial, and cortisone skin cream mixtures, especially those containing nystatin. A 1% ethylenediamine in petrolatum is the recommended concentration used for patch testing.
